Game Recap: Women's Soccer |

Bulldogs roll to 5-0 home win over Centenary College (La.)


SEGUIN, Texas -- Texas Lutheran Women's Soccer avenged an early-season conference loss to Centenary College (La.) with a 5-0 win over The Ladies Sunday at Gustafson Field.

TLU led 4-0 after the first half with goals from Bailey Nimtz (1:27), Jaclyn Smolik (8:33), Calista Goode (9:08), and Monique Sierra (21:14).

Sierra, a freshman from San Antonio (Taft), added a second goal at the 48:36 mark in the second half. Sierra also assisted on Smolik's goal.

TLU had six total shots in the first half, and four of those shots found the back of the net. 

Nimtz scored on her corner kick that curved into the far post in the second minute.

TLU improved to 2-4-1 overall and to 1-3 in the Southern Collegiate Athletic Conference.

Centenary dropped to 6-3 overall and to 4-3 in the SCAC.

TLU out-shot Centenary 17-6 and had an 8-4 edge in shots on goal.

TLU keepers Stephanie Barrientos and Erin Davila each saw action. Barrientos played 70:18 and had two saves. Davila played the final 19:42 and had two saves.

The Bulldogs hit the road for their next conference contest, a 7 p.m. matchup Friday in Georgetown, Texas against Southwestern University.
